Chatty Cathy was a pull-string "talking" doll originally created by Ruth and Elliot Handler and manufactured by the Mattel toy company from 1959 to 1965. The doll was first released in stores and appeared in television commercials beginning in 1960, with a suggested retail price of $18.00, though usually priced under $10.00 in catalog advertisements.
Charmin' Chatty was a doll produced by the toy company Mattel in 1963 and 1964. The doll, introduced at the American Toy Fair in New York City in March 1963, [citation needed] belonged to a line of highly successful talking dolls introduced in 1960 (Chatty Cathy was the first of these dolls).
In reality, Brikette was a non-talker; on The Twilight Zone she was modeled after Chatty Cathy, a popular talking doll manufactured by Mattel at the time "Living Doll" aired. The voices for both Chatty Cathy and Talky Tina were provided by June Foray, one of the leading voice actresses of the era. [3]
